Isn't it Xenon -> Zephyr -> Falcon -> Jasper?
AFAIK, Xenon was 90nm/90nm, Zephyr was 90nm/65nm, Falcon 65nm/65nm and Jasper expected to be 45nm.

Falcon must be the best choice right now, produces noticably less heat compared to 90nm chipsets. Still not immune to RROD though.

Look behind your power brick, do you see "Output DC 175W MAX"? If yes, you have a Falcon. If you see 203W MAX or something else, then you have an older model.
 
Also there should be a white sticker on the 360's box, it should say the team it was made by.

Mine's made by Team FDOU, and is a Falcon

65nm models produces considerably less heat. If you have someone with a Core/Premium, you could make a quick comparison of the temperature after playing for maybe an hour each.

The chance of RROD isn't TOO different. There are obviously fewer people with newer chipsets than older ones, so you don't see as many people complaining about their new model getting RROD.
(Also 65nm models' been around for a significantly shorter period of time compared to the 90nm ones)
But the bottom line is, producing less heat = safer than before.
